File Database: Peran Pentingnya dalam PengelFile Database: Peran Pentingnya dalam Pengelolaan Informasi Modernolaan Informasi Modern

File Database: Pengertian, Fungsi, dan Perannya dalam Dunia Digital

JAKARTA, adminca.sch.id – Dalam dunia modern yang serba digital, data menjadi komponen penting bagi hampir setiap aspek kehidupan manusia. Semua informasi yang kita gunakan setiap hari, mulai dari kontak di ponsel, transaksi perbankan, hingga catatan akademik di sekolah, tersimpan dalam suatu sistem yang disebut file database. Meskipun istilah ini terdengar teknis, sebenarnya konsepnya cukup sederhana dan menarik untuk dipahami.

Artikel ini akan membahas secara lengkap tentang file database, mulai dari pengertian, fungsi, struktur, hingga contohnya dalam kehidupan nyata.

Apa Itu File Database?

File Database: Peran Pentingnya dalam PengelFile Database: Peran Pentingnya dalam Pengelolaan Informasi Modernolaan Informasi Modern

Sebelum melangkah lebih jauh, mari kita pahami dulu apa itu file database.
Secara sederhana, file database adalah kumpulan data yang disimpan dalam satu atau beberapa file di komputer. File ini berfungsi untuk menyimpan, mengelola, serta memudahkan pengguna dalam mengakses dan memanipulasi data.

Dalam dunia pemrograman maupun sistem informasi, file database berperan penting karena mampu mengorganisir data dalam format yang mudah diakses. Misalnya, file dengan ekstensi seperti .db, .mdb, .sqlite, atau .accdb adalah contoh nyata dari database yang sering digunakan.

Selain itu, database menjadi dasar bagi berbagai aplikasi seperti Microsoft Access, SQLite, atau MySQL yang sering digunakan untuk mengelola data secara sistematis.

Fungsi Utama File Database

File database memiliki beragam fungsi penting yang membantu sistem komputer maupun aplikasi bekerja secara efisien. Berikut adalah beberapa fungsi utamanya:

  1. Menyimpan Data Secara Terstruktur
    File database menyimpan informasi dalam bentuk tabel, kolom, dan baris, sehingga data mudah diakses dan dikelola.

  2. Memudahkan Pengambilan Data
    Dengan menggunakan query atau perintah tertentu, pengguna bisa dengan cepat mencari informasi yang dibutuhkan tanpa harus membuka seluruh file.

  3. Menjaga Konsistensi Data
    Sistem database dirancang agar data tidak saling bertentangan. Misalnya, jika satu data diubah, maka perubahan itu akan berdampak pada bagian lain yang terkait.

  4. Menghemat Waktu dan Ruang Penyimpanan
    Karena data disimpan secara efisien, penggunaan ruang penyimpanan menjadi lebih hemat, dan waktu akses data juga lebih cepat.

  5. Mendukung Multiuser Access
    Banyak sistem database modern memungkinkan beberapa pengguna mengakses data secara bersamaan tanpa saling mengganggu.

Struktur Dasar File Database

Sebuah file database tidak hanya sekadar kumpulan data biasa. Di dalamnya terdapat struktur tertentu agar sistem bisa memahami dan mengelola informasi dengan baik. Struktur umum database meliputi:

  • Tabel (Tables): Berisi kumpulan data yang tersusun dalam baris dan kolom.

  • Field (Kolom): Menunjukkan kategori atau jenis data seperti nama, alamat, atau harga.

  • Record (Baris): Merupakan satu set data lengkap untuk satu entitas tertentu.

  • Primary Key: Sebuah kolom yang berfungsi sebagai pengenal unik untuk setiap record.

  • Relationship: Hubungan antara tabel satu dengan tabel lainnya.

Dengan struktur ini, database mampu menyimpan data dalam jumlah besar namun tetap rapi dan mudah diatur.

Jenis-Jenis  yang Umum Digunakan

Terdapat beberapa jenis database yang sering digunakan di berbagai sistem. Setiap jenis memiliki kelebihan dan karakteristik tersendiri.

  1. Flat File Database
    Ini adalah bentuk paling sederhana dari database. Data disimpan dalam satu file teks, biasanya dengan format .csv atau .txt.

  2. Relational Database
    Jenis ini paling populer, di mana data disimpan dalam tabel-tabel yang saling berhubungan. Contohnya seperti MySQL, PostgreSQL, dan SQLite.

  3. Object-Oriented Database
    Data disimpan dalam bentuk objek, mirip seperti konsep dalam pemrograman berorientasi objek.

  4. Hierarchical Database
    Data disusun dalam bentuk pohon (tree), dengan hubungan antar data berupa parent dan child.

  5. Network Database
    Mirip seperti hierarchical database, tetapi setiap data bisa memiliki banyak hubungan dengan data lainnya.

Kelebihan Menggunakan File Database

Tidak bisa dipungkiri, penggunaan database membawa banyak manfaat, baik dalam bisnis, pendidikan, maupun sistem pemerintahan. Beberapa kelebihannya antara lain:

  • Efisiensi Pengelolaan Data: Semua data bisa dikelola dalam satu sistem yang terorganisir.

  • Keamanan yang Lebih Baik: File database modern memiliki fitur enkripsi untuk melindungi data sensitif.

  • Akses Data yang Cepat: Dengan query yang tepat, informasi dapat ditemukan dalam hitungan detik.

  • Kemudahan Backup dan Restore: File database dapat dengan mudah disalin atau dipulihkan bila terjadi kerusakan.

  • Integrasi dengan Aplikasi Lain: Banyak aplikasi modern seperti ERP, CRM, dan sistem akuntansi bergantung pada database.

Kelemahan File Database

Meskipun memiliki banyak keunggulan, database juga memiliki beberapa keterbatasan, seperti:

  • Kapasitas Terbatas: Beberapa format database tidak cocok untuk menyimpan data dalam jumlah besar.

  • Sulit Dikelola Secara Manual: Mengedit langsung isi database tanpa sistem khusus bisa berisiko menyebabkan error.

  • Masalah Kinerja: Jika tidak dioptimalkan, database bisa lambat saat menangani data besar.

  • Keamanan Tergantung Sistem: Tanpa perlindungan tambahan, database bisa mudah diakses oleh pihak yang tidak berwenang.

Contoh Penggunaan dalam Kehidupan Nyata

Dalam kehidupan sehari-hari, tanpa disadari kita sering berinteraksi dengan sistem yang menggunakan file database. Misalnya:

  • Aplikasi Kontak di Smartphone: Menyimpan nama, nomor telepon, dan alamat dalam satu file database.

  • E-commerce: Menyimpan data produk, pelanggan, dan transaksi.

  • Perbankan: Mengelola jutaan transaksi dan saldo rekening secara otomatis.

  • Sekolah dan Universitas: Mengatur data siswa, nilai, serta jadwal pelajaran.

Menariknya, di salah satu paragraf ini, penulis pernah menggunakan Microsoft Access untuk membuat sistem inventori sederhana berbasis file database saat kuliah. Dengan database tersebut, semua stok barang bisa diatur otomatis tanpa kesulitan besar. Pengalaman itu membuktikan betapa pentingnya peran database dalam dunia nyata.

Hubungan dengan Sistem Manajemen Basis Data (DBMS)

File database tidak bisa berdiri sendiri tanpa bantuan DBMS (Database Management System). DBMS adalah perangkat lunak yang membantu pengguna untuk membuat, mengelola, dan memanipulasi file database.

Beberapa contoh DBMS populer antara lain:

  • MySQL

  • Oracle Database

  • PostgreSQL

  • SQLite

  • Microsoft SQL Server

Tanpa DBMS, pengguna akan kesulitan untuk mengakses atau memperbarui data karena harus berurusan langsung dengan file mentah yang kompleks.

Cara Kerja dalam Sistem Digital

Secara umum, cara kerja file database cukup sederhana namun efisien:

  1. Data dimasukkan ke dalam tabel melalui antarmuka aplikasi.

  2. Sistem menyimpan data dalam file database dengan format tertentu.

  3. Saat pengguna membutuhkan informasi, sistem akan mencari data menggunakan query.

  4. Data kemudian ditampilkan sesuai permintaan pengguna.

Dengan cara kerja ini, database memungkinkan ribuan hingga jutaan data diolah secara cepat tanpa harus diakses satu per satu.

Tips Mengelola  Secara Efektif

Agar file database tetap optimal dan aman, beberapa tips berikut bisa diterapkan:

  • Lakukan Backup Secara Berkala: Hindari kehilangan data akibat kerusakan sistem.

  • Gunakan Password dan Enkripsi: Lindungi database dari akses ilegal.

  • Optimalkan Query: Gunakan perintah SQL yang efisien untuk mempercepat kinerja.

  • Gunakan Index: Membantu mempercepat pencarian data di tabel besar.

  • Gunakan Versi DBMS Terbaru: Pembaruan sistem sering membawa peningkatan keamanan dan kecepatan.

Peran File Database di Era Big Data dan Cloud

Dalam era digital saat ini, penggunaan file database telah berkembang pesat. Kini, sistem database tidak hanya tersimpan secara lokal di komputer, tetapi juga di cloud.

Platform seperti Google Firebase, Amazon RDS, atau Microsoft Azure SQL menggunakan konsep file database untuk mengelola data secara terdistribusi. Hal ini memungkinkan perusahaan untuk menyimpan dan mengakses data dari berbagai lokasi secara real time.

Fondasi dari Dunia Digital Modern

Secara keseluruhan, file database adalah tulang punggung dari berbagai sistem informasi yang kita gunakan setiap hari. Dari aplikasi sederhana hingga sistem bisnis skala besar, semuanya bergantung pada kemampuan  database dalam menyimpan dan mengelola data secara efisien.

Dengan memahami konsep, fungsi, serta penerapannya, kita tidak hanya menjadi pengguna data, tetapi juga dapat mengelola dan mengembangkan sistem yang lebih cerdas dan efektif di masa depan.

Jadi, mulai sekarang, mari kita sadari bahwa setiap klik dan setiap informasi yang tersimpan — kemungkinan besar berasal dari database yang bekerja tanpa henti di balik layar teknologi modern.

Temukan informasi lengkapnya Tentang: Pengetahuan

Baca Juga Artikel Berikut: Dokumen Pajak: Panduan Lengkap Mengelola dan Memahami Administrasi Pajak

Author